Oh how I love a simple sketch that allows you the option of going CAS or going wild.  Your mood, card purpose or crafty time allotment can determine the outcome.  Happy dance time :)

I chose to go a bit wild on this one, as this is my very first, official, doily card -- just for you Moe ;)  I recently received some as a gift and couldn't wait to use one on a card (what can I say, I'm slow on the trends lol).  All that to say, the doily made me stray from the sketch a bit, but the guts of it are still there.

Pulled out three of my favorite Verve dies:  Jotted Heart, the heart die from the Scalloped Trim Trio set, and my beloved "U" die from the I Heart You die set.  The papers are from MME's Love Me set.

What's In It?
Stamps:   Twitterpated (Verve Stamps)
Paper:  Love Me (My Mind's Eye), Real Red, Kraft (Stampin' Up),  
Ink: Black  
Accessories: 
Jotted Heart, I Heart You and Scalloped Trim Trio Dies (A Cut Above by Verve), 5/8" White Satin Ribbon (Michael's), Doily, Button, Twine, Glue Dots, Dimensionals
